What is a Crypto Chart?


A crypto chart is a powerful tool that shows how the price of a cryptocurrency moves over time. It helps traders understand the market by visualizing price trends, patterns, and trading activity. These charts are essential for anyone looking to make smarter trading decisions based on reliable data.

The main purpose of a crypto chart is to turn complex market information into an easy-to-read format. It shows price changes in specific time frames, like 1 minute, 1 hour, or 1 day. This makes it easier for traders to spot trends, identify opportunities, and avoid risky trades. Research shows that 65% of traders use crypto charts for decision-making, and those who rely on charts see a 30% higher success rate compared to others.

Key elements of a crypto chart include price action, volume, and technical indicators. Price action refers to how a cryptocurrency's price changes, often displayed as candlestick patterns. For example, a green candlestick shows the price went up, while a red candlestick shows it went down. Volume measures how much of the cryptocurrency is traded, which helps indicate market interest. Indicators like moving averages or RSI (Relative Strength Index) help predict price movements and confirm trends.

Simple tools like trendlines are also important. They show the general direction of a cryptocurrency's price, whether it’s moving up or down. Why Are Crypto Charts Essential for Trade Analysis?


Crypto charts are vital tools for traders aiming to make smart and informed decisions in the volatile cryptocurrency market. These charts help traders spot key patterns, trends, and critical support and resistance levels, all of which are crucial for predicting future price movements. For example, chart patterns like head and shoulders, double tops, and triangles often signal trend reversals or continuation. Recognizing these patterns can give traders valuable insights into potential market changes, helping them decide when to enter or exit a trade.

Support and resistance levels are especially important in crypto charts. Support represents the price level at which demand is strong enough to prevent the price from falling further, while resistance is the price point where selling pressure is strong enough to prevent the price from rising. These levels are essential because they indicate where the market is likely to reverse or break out. By identifying these levels, traders can time their trades more effectively, enter at the right price, and set stop-loss orders to protect their profits.

Crypto analysis relies heavily on chart insights. Technical indicators, such as moving averages, RSI (Relative Strength Index), and MACD (Moving Average Convergence Divergence), help traders validate trends and predict price movements. For example, moving averages help smooth out price data to identify trends, while RSI shows if a cryptocurrency is overbought or oversold, signaling potential trend reversals. The MACD indicator shows changes in momentum, helping traders understand whether an asset is gaining or losing strength. By combining these indicators with price action (which analyzes the price movement itself), traders can make more informed predictions about where the market is headed.

Understanding the Key Elements of a Crypto Chart

A crypto chart is essential for traders to analyze price movements over time and make informed trading decisions. It’s made up of several key elements, each providing valuable insights into market trends and potential trade opportunities.

1. Candlestick Patterns

Candlestick patterns are one of the most important features of a crypto chart. Each candlestick shows the open, close, high, and low prices for a specific period. The color of the candlestick (green for bullish, red for bearish) reveals market sentiment. Recognizing candlestick patterns such as Doji, Engulfing, and Hammer helps traders identify potential market reversals. Statistical data shows that 65% of professional traders rely on candlestick patterns to forecast market direction and make timely trade decisions. These patterns help traders spot moments when price action is likely to change, providing critical entry or exit points for trades.

2. Support and Resistance Levels

Support and resistance levels are vital in crypto chart analysis. Support refers to a price point where an asset tends to find buying interest, causing the price to halt or bounce back upwards. Conversely, resistance is where the price faces selling pressure, causing it to stall or reverse. Traders use these levels to anticipate future price movements. Statistical data shows that 80% of traders use support and resistance levels to guide their entry and exit points. When the price breaks through these levels, it often signals significant price movements, either a breakout or a breakdown, depending on the direction of the breakout. This makes support and resistance critical for identifying trade opportunities and managing risk.

3. Moving Averages and Other Technical Indicators

Moving averages are used to identify trends by smoothing out price data over a set period, helping traders spot whether the market is in an uptrend or downtrend. The Simple Moving Average (SMA) and Exponential Moving Average (EMA) are popular tools for detecting trend direction. SMA calculates the average price over a set number of periods, while EMA gives more weight to recent price movements, making it more responsive. Additionally, technical indicators like Relative Strength Index (RSI) and Moving Average Convergence Divergence (MACD) provide insights into market conditions such as momentum and overbought/oversold conditions. Top Crypto Chart Indicators to Watch in 2025

In 2025, using the right crypto chart indicators is crucial for traders to stay ahead of the market. These indicators help traders make informed decisions based on price movements and market trends. Here are three of the most important indicators to watch:

  1. Relative Strength Index (RSI) The RSI is one of the most commonly used momentum oscillators. It measures the speed and change of price movements on a scale from 0 to 100. Typically, an RSI reading above 70 suggests the asset is overbought, indicating a possible price correction. Conversely, an RSI reading below 30 signals the asset is oversold, which might present a buying opportunity. According to a survey, over 60% of traders rely on RSI to identify potential reversal points. When combined with other indicators, the RSI can help traders improve the accuracy of their entry and exit points, increasing the likelihood of profitable trades.

  2. MACD (Moving Average Convergence Divergence) The MACD is a trend-following momentum indicator that calculates the difference between two moving averages of an asset’s price: the 12-day exponential moving average (EMA) and the 26-day EMA. The result is the MACD line, which is used in conjunction with the signal line (the 9-day EMA of the MACD line). When the MACD line crosses above the signal line, it signals bullish momentum, suggesting a potential buying opportunity. When the MACD line crosses below the signal line, it signals bearish momentum, suggesting a potential selling point. Studies show that 40% of professional traders use the MACD to track market momentum and confirm price trends. The MACD is particularly useful for identifying trend reversals and maintaining strong entry and exit strategies.

  3. Bollinger Bands Bollinger Bands are a volatility indicator that consists of three lines: a middle band (which is a simple moving average), an upper band, and a lower band. The upper and lower bands are typically set two standard deviations above and below the middle band. As volatility increases, the bands widen, and when volatility decreases, the bands contract. Traders watch for price movements that approach or break through the outer bands. If the price reaches the upper band, it suggests the asset is overbought, and if it hits the lower band, the asset may be oversold. According to recent research, 50% of traders use Bollinger Bands to identify periods of high or low volatility, providing key insights into potential price breakouts or breakdowns.
